JK craves for peace, responsive governance: Slathia

Vijaypur: Former minister and senior leader Surjeet Singh Slathia today described National Conference a mass movement and representative of marginalised segments of the people of Jammu and Kashmir, saying this alone can satiate the urges and aspirations of the people.in a statement issued here said .

“People of this part of the country are craving for peace and good governance, which can be ensured by National Conference alone”, Slathia said while addressing Sarpanchs, Panchs and during the party meetings at village Chack Dayala, Burj Tanda, Rakh Brotian, Kothi, Gagore Jamorian and Kamala this afternoon.

Slathia said that times bear testimony that NC never compromised its people centric agenda and high values of secular democratic ethos. “We have braved the brunt of misinformation campaign but never let down the people who have their distinct urges and asprations”, he said and cautioned against the machinations being perpetrated by anti-people forces to weaken the party.

“They have exploited the people by raking up emotive and divisive slogans to put hurdles in the forward movement of National Conference to seek permanent peace and youth their welfare”, he said and added that these elements have neither in the past deterred National Conference nor at present will be able to do so as people fully recognize them as a spent force, who have only furthered their personal agendas.

The senior National Conference leader said that, being the peoples’ movement this party has always surmounted the challenges with resilience and fortitude at the strength of its dedicated cadre and would do so always with a sense of commitment. He exhorted the cadre to gear up for challenges unfolded by the divisive elements and help in retaining the sheen of Jammu and Kashmir, which is a repository of unity and tranquility. He also urged them to fan out in their respective areas and help in building a society based on trust, love and compassion. Slathia expressed concern over attempts being made to vitiate the political atmosphere and said politics of hate and intolerance is a real threat to democracy that is needed to be fought collectively by the democratic forces. He urged the people, especially the youth to play their designated role in steering J&K to peace, prosperity and development. For this they will have to vote and support the National Conference candidates with thumping majority to make the grass roots level democratic institutions as engine of change. “Your vote will be vote for development and prosperity of the people, irrespective of region, religion, caste or creed”, Slathia added.
